Don't forget that you should also include a list of other shared apps. It
might be ok that TwitterShare inherits 'take a picture' and such, but not so
good that 'ContactStealer' inherits internet access. (And if TS is the 2nd
app installed, it won't indicate the first.)

> When a new application is installed with a shared_ID and common
> signature, it will gain automatically all permissions already granted
> to other installed applications with the same shared_ID and signature.
>
> In the case , I guess it could be useful to display to the end-user,
> before confirming the new application installation, the list of all
> the permissions, this application will have, even if they are not
> requested in the application manifest.
>
> Indeed, if this new application really needs such permission, then the
> user may still decide to install it.
> Otherwise, he may simply prefer install an other application version
> that will not have the shared ID, and will be "less dangerous" (less
> granted permission), due to less automatically granted permissions.
>
> The shared ID scheme is useful for developer and software update/
> modularity, but could be maliciously exploited as described in the
> previous thread. The more information the end-user will have about
> granted permissions, the better choice about the installation and its
> consequences, he will make.

> > >> Say I'm a user of average technological savvy -- I know that the
> > >> padlock icon on my pc browser means things are safe, I don't like
> > >> connecting to unknown WiFi points because I've heard there's snooping
> > >> going on, but I'm not a computer weenie -- I'm just an average user.
> > >> Say I also like cute widgets.
> > >>
> > >> Say someobody writes four applications that use protected APIs, sells
> > >> them as a package called MyCuteWidgetsSuite or individually. The apps
> > >> are as follows:
> > >>
> > >> MyRingerPhoneBook requires access to the phonebook on the device so
> > >> that I can attach a nice little sound to each contact when I scroll
> > >> over. It specifies READ_CONTACTS in the Manifest as a required
> > >> permission. I allow it to run because while I know it reads my
> > >> contacts, it says nothing about sending things over network -- so I
> > >> think my contact data is safe.
> > >>
> > >> MyPhoneCallFireworks is a little app that shows a cute animation
> > >> whenever I make a phone call. It specifies PROCESS_OUTGOING_CALLS  in
> > >> the Manifest as a required permission. I allow it to run because well,
> > >> it makes sense to do so and there is nothing about sending things over
> > >> the network.
> > >>
> > >> MySparkleSMS is a little app that shows a cute little sparkly rainbow
> > >> whenever I get an SMS from a friend, and that puts invisible
> > >> characters in outgoing SMS messages so that other friends with
> > >> MySparkleSMS will get my sparkly rainbow when I send them a message.
> > >> It specifies RECEIVE_SMS and SEND_SMS. This makes sense to me because,
> > >> yes, it's an SMS application
> > >>
> > >> MyPhoneCallWhenNear is a little app that automatically calls my
> > >> buddies when they're within two blocks of me. It specifies CALL_PHONE
> > >> and ACCESS_COARSE_LOCATION and INTERNET in the manifest. The whole
> > >> Internet thing kind of wigs me out a bit, but I already installed two
> > >> other apps in the suite months ago and they've been behaving very
> > >> nicely, plus it's not using GPS but just WiFi location... I guess I
> > >> can trust the app. Sure, I will allow it to run.
> > >>
> > >> Each application has sharedUserId specified in the Manifest, and all
> > >> apps are signed under the same self signed certificate. According to
> > >> Android documentation (http://developer.android.com/guide/topics/
> > >> security/security.html<
> http://developer.android.com/guide/topics/%0Asecurity/security.html>),
> > >> all these applications share privileges. They
> > >> are, in essence, one big application with a whole host of permissions.
> > >>
> > >> Say MyCuteWidgetsSuite was written not by a lover of sparkly things
> > >> but by a shady character in East Evilonia, and that in 12 months,
> > >> after the apps have been on the top-10 downloads list in the
> > >> Marketplace and highly rated by lots of lovers of sparklies, the apps
> > >> will wake up and download all my call logs, contact information, a
> > >> record of my location movements and my full SMS message trails to a
> > >> server It will also be able to open up an internet connection to a
> > >> server, make outgoing phone calls without my knowing it (and listen to
> > >> my conversations), and send SMS messages silently, helping it become
> > >> part of a an SMS and phone dialer spam zombienet.
> > >>
> > >> Question:
> > >> Is this a plausible scenario? Or is there something I'm missing about
> > >> self-signing and security between applications with the same cert/UID?
> > >> What in the Android Security Model prevents this kind of scenario?
